Can TopPette be Used in a Car?

Functionality

The primary function of TopPette pipettes is to transfer small and precise volumes of liquid. In a laboratory, they are used with a stable workbench, proper lighting, and a controlled environment. In a car, the situation is quite different. The car is a mobile environment, subject to vibrations, accelerations, and decelerations. These movements can make it extremely difficult to handle the pipette accurately. For example, when the car brakes suddenly, the liquid in the pipette may be displaced, leading to inaccurate volume measurements.

Moreover, the lighting conditions in a car are often not ideal for pipetting. In a laboratory, there are usually bright, white - light sources that allow the user to clearly see the liquid level in the pipette tip. In a car, the light may be dim, and the color temperature may not be suitable for accurate visual inspection. This can increase the risk of errors during pipetting.

Safety

Safety is another important aspect to consider. Most laboratory pipettes are designed to handle chemicals and biological samples. In a car, there is a risk of spillage. If a chemical or biological sample spills in the car, it can be a hazard to the passengers. For example, some chemicals may be corrosive or toxic, and if they come into contact with the skin, eyes, or are inhaled, they can cause serious health problems.

In addition, the car's interior is not designed to be a chemical - resistant environment. Spilled chemicals can damage the car's upholstery, dashboard, and other components. There is also a risk of fire if the spilled liquid is flammable.

Practicality

From a practical perspective, using TopPette in a car is not very convenient. Pipetting requires a certain amount of space and a stable surface. In a car, the space is limited, and the seats and dashboard are not designed to be used as a pipetting workbench. The user may have to contort their body to reach the pipette and the sample, which can be uncomfortable and increase the risk of errors.

Special Cases Where TopPette Might be Used in a Car

There are some special cases where using TopPette in a car could be considered. For example, in field research where samples need to be processed immediately after collection. If the car is parked in a stable position, and the environment inside the car can be made relatively stable (e.g., by turning off the engine to reduce vibrations), and proper safety precautions are taken, it may be possible to use TopPette for quick, on - site pipetting. However, this should be done with extreme caution and only in situations where there are no other alternatives.

Recommendations

Based on the above analysis, we generally do not recommend using TopPette in a car. However, if you find yourself in a situation where you need to use pipettes in a non - laboratory environment, here are some suggestions:

  1. Choose a stable location: If possible, park the car on a flat surface and turn off the engine to minimize vibrations.
  2. Use proper lighting: Bring a portable, bright light source to ensure that you can clearly see the liquid level in the pipette tip.
  3. Take safety precautions: Wear appropriate personal protective equipment, such as gloves and goggles. Have a spill - containment kit on hand in case of an accident.
  4. Minimize the risk of spillage: Use pipette tips with secure seals and handle the pipette carefully.
